Checklist item 12: Before publishing a plugin compatible with the Stockmend reconciliation job, confirm your adapter handles the new delta-ledger format and returns explicit zero counts rather than nulls. Run the conformance harness against the staging warehouse snapshot and attach the pass report to your submission. Plugins that skip the harness will be rejected automatically. Reference the build token printed directly below in your compatibility manifest.

pipeline stamp: htk9_ce63042d9

## Flaky Payments Tests — Who to Poke

Seeing random failures in the Tollgate payments suite? It's usually the mock ledger timing out, not your change. Retry once before blaming yourself. Known flaky cases are tagged `tollgate-flake` in the tracker. If you hit a new one, or a retry doesn't fix it, message the payments reliability folks.

escalation mailbox, hadug-bajog: sormir@norvalabs.internal

**Ticket: Websocket reconnect storm on Larkspur gateway**

Reconnect loops hit prod Tuesday. Root cause: config drift between the Bramleyfield cluster and staging. Staging had backoff jitter enabled; prod did not, so clients hammered the gateway in lockstep after every deploy. Nobody noticed because the drift checker excludes the realtime namespace. Fix: re-add the namespace to drift scans and pin the reconnect settings in the Larkspur repo. For reference, the values prod should be running are as follows.

config for bahof-tagep:
kelael:
  pin: 3701
  tenant: fraius
  seal: seal_566287a7
  metrics_host: metrics.kelael.ferradyn.local
  standby_team: sormir
  escalation: juldor-oliir
  nonce: 530523

# Break-Glass: Catalog Cache Invalidation

Scope: the Pinrow product catalog at Veldstone Retail. If stale prices persist after a purge and the Hollowmere invalidation queue is wedged, use break-glass to flush the edge tier directly. Contractors: get verbal sign-off from the catalog lead first. Steps: open the Hollowmere admin shell, select emergency-flush, confirm the tenant, and run it once — repeated flushes thrash the origin. Access is logged and expires after 20 minutes. Unseal the admin shell with the passphrase below.

recovery phrase for kahop-tajog: istix-casvan